### Nightly Backfill Scheduler — Capacity Note

Quick heads-up for whoever's on call: the Mulberry backfill scheduler at Copperfen is getting close to its window. Nightly jobs now take about five hours end to end, and the 2am analytics crunch is squeezing worker availability. We're bumping concurrency slightly and tightening the per-job timeout so stragglers get killed instead of eating the pool. Nothing scary, but watch the queue depth dashboard for a few nights. The new scheduler constants are listed below.

tuning constants:
QUOTAS = {
    "druwyn": 5,
    "holix": 5,
    "zorath": 5,
    "holwyn": 10,
}

Environments: Telemetry Compression (Larkspindle)

All Larkspindle environments now compress telemetry payloads before shipping to the collector. Staging uses aggressive compression for bandwidth testing; prod favors CPU headroom. Uncompressed fallback is disabled everywhere except the sandbox tier. Mixed-version fleets must agree on codec before cutover. Each environment runs with the following settings.

settings of kagap-fajep:
[zorys]
team = ulavan
access_code = ac_08fa8f
host = zorys.kelvinet.corp
port = 3000
owner = wenix.weneth
peer = wenath.brasksys.test

// Pool client for the Driftgate metrics store.
// Max 20 connections, 30s idle timeout, TLS enforced.
// Credentials are not read from env here; this module is
// initialized once at boot and audited quarterly.
// Scope is read-only against the reporting schema.
// The service authenticates with the internal key below.

gateway credential: kto23_LX9A4ys6i4nzHtpOLNLodKK

## Break-glass: Ferngate bloom filter

If the bloom filter fronting the Ferngate KV store starts returning garbage, you can bypass it via the break-glass console and hit the store directly. Expect latency to spike — that's fine, it's temporary. The console will ask for the break-glass recovery passphrase, which is recorded just below.

strongbox words: briiel-zoreth-noveth-pelys-druwyn-feniel-lamvan-ulaius-kasion